Scan Pro Video – For pro user or enthusiasts

Scan Pro Video have a been a business unit within Scan for over 10 years, our tight-knit team of experts have over 25 years of industry experience across photography, video production, post-production, broadcast and more. With unique access to expertise from industry-specific business units spanning across audio, graphics, gaming, AI, digital signage and IT, this means the Scan Pro Video team are able to support the most dynamic of workflows.

Tomasz Sypryt – Technical Content Creator & Business Development Manager

“My background is in Film, Broadcast Technology and Post Production.
After more than 7 years of a career in finance at a major UK bank, I decided to follow my dreams and hone my skills as a photographer and videographer, and decided to pursue a full-time career in filmmaking, starting with obtaining a degree in Film Production.

After freelancing as a camera operator and camera assistant, I secured a role at Blackmagic Design as part of the Technical Support team, and quickly progressed to the Technical Sales department for EMEA region; educating channel partners, consulting business clients, and working with industry partners around camera technologies, codecs, professional colour workflows and live production.

I joined the Scan Pro Video team as Technical Content and Business Development Manager, and I’m now applying my knowledge of Post Production and live production, to help grow the business. In my spare time, I am currently diving deep into learning Unreal Engine.”

Duncan McKendrick – Technical Product Manager

“I have been involved in the film & television industry for over 20 years. During this time, I've worked freelance as a cameraman, editor, sound recordist, & producer on various television productions, live music concerts & festivals and several prime-time BBC documentaries & productions.

My previous roles include Hire Manager & Head of Drama & Commercials for two well-known Broadcast & cine equipment hire rental companies based in Manchester.

This involved technical consulting & advising on all manner of digital cinema camera, lighting & grip equipment. In September 2022 I joined the Pro Video department of Scan as a Technical Product Manager.”
